What Are Cookies
A cookie is a small text file. Your browser stores it when you land on a site, and the site can read it next time you visit. No code runs, nothing gets installed – it’s just data sitting quietly on your device. vegasherocasino.gb.net uses cookies to keep the platform working properly, hold onto your settings between visits, and build a picture of how the site actually gets used day to day.
Browsers accept cookies by default. You can change that in your settings, and we’ll cover how below. Worth knowing upfront though: some cookies are essential to how vegasherocasino.gb.net functions. Turn those off and things start breaking – login stops working, sessions drop, basic navigation goes wrong.
Types of Cookies We Use
Not all cookies do the same job, and lumping them together doesn’t help anyone understand what’s actually going on. Here’s how the ones on vegasherocasino.gb.net break down:
- Essential cookies – the site doesn’t function without these. They handle login sessions, security checks, and basic navigation. There’s no opt-out because there’s no version of vegasherocasino.gb.net that works without them.
- Analytics cookies – tell us which pages get traffic, where sessions tend to end, how long people stay, and what paths they take through the site. No names or account details attached – just patterns that help us improve things.
- Preference cookies – store your settings between visits so you’re not starting from scratch every time you come back. Language choice, display preferences, that kind of thing.
- Session cookies – temporary by design. They exist only while your browser is open and get deleted the moment you close it. Their job is to keep your current session intact while you’re actively on the site.
